Welcome to Mirror Football’s transfer live blog, where we keep track of the day’s gossip, rumours and news ahead of the window swinging open.
Arsenal are just one of the big clubs in the market for new recruits this summer, and have been in hot-pursuit of Thomas Partey.
But according to reports the deal appears to be dead in the water, with the £43million-rated Atletico Madrid midfielder set to pen an extension in Spain.
Elsewhere, Pep Guardiola is set to be handed a £150million transfer warchest at Manchester City this summer, in a bid to compete with Liverpool next season.
The Citizens already have their eye on Wolves striker Raul Jimenez, and have even been linked with Tottenham defender Jan Vertonghen.
Across the city, Manchester United remain perpetually linked with £85million-rated England international Jadon Sancho.
While back down south Chelsea have received a boost by the news Kai Havertz wouldn’t be put off signing if the Blues fail to secure Champions League football next season.
Currently, Frank Lampard’s men are third and in a position to do so, but Manchester United and Leicester City are also in the mix.
